PVC Profiles

PVC profiles are widely used in the food and beverage industry for their durability, ease of cleaning, and resistance to moisture and bacteria. These profiles offer a number of benefits, including:

  1. Hygiene: PVC is easy to clean and sanitize, making it ideal for use in food and beverage plants where cleanliness is essential.

  2. Moisture resistance: PVC is highly resistant to moisture, making it suitable for use in environments where liquids are present.

  3. Durability: PVC is strong and durable, making it suitable for use in the construction of food and beverage processing equipment and storage systems.

  4. Cost-effectiveness: PVC is a cost-effective material compared to other materials, making it a popular choice for food and beverage facilities with budget constraints.

  5. Versatility: PVC profiles can be easily shaped and molded to meet the specific needs of each food and beverage facility, allowing for the creation of customized solutions.

Polyurethane Seam Sealant

Polyurethane seam sealant is a type of adhesive sealant commonly used in construction and automotive industries to seal joints, seams, and gaps in surfaces. It is known for its high elasticity, durability, and resistance to weathering, making it ideal for use in a variety of applications. The sealant can be easily applied using a standard caulking gun and dries to form a flexible, water-resistant bond. With its fast-drying formula, polyurethane seam sealant is perfect for projects where quick results are needed, and its ability to maintain its shape and structure over time ensures long-lasting protection from moisture, air, and dust.

Aluminium Profiles

Aluminum profiles are commonly used in food and beverage plants for their strength, durability, and resistance to corrosion. These profiles offer a number of advantages over traditional materials, including:

  1. Hygiene: Aluminum profiles are easy to clean and maintain, making them ideal for use in food and beverage plants where sanitation is a top priority.

  2. Resistance to corrosion: Aluminum is resistant to corrosion and does not react with food and beverage products, making it an ideal material for use in these facilities.

  3. Strength: Aluminum profiles offer high strength and durability, making them ideal for use in the construction of food and beverage processing equipment and storage systems.

  4. Lightweight: Aluminum is a lightweight material, making it easy to handle and transport, and reducing the overall weight of food and beverage processing equipment.

  5. Customization: Aluminum profiles can be easily customized to meet the specific needs of each food and beverage facility, allowing for the creation of tailored solutions that meet specific operational requirements.
